Subject: Handover — Dashlume admin dark mode

Taking over release duties from Priya this cycle. Dark-mode support ships in Dashlume Admin 4.2; plugin authors must declare a theme manifest or your panels render with legacy styles. CSS token map is in the plugin SDK docs. Deadline for compatibility submissions is Friday. Untested plugins get flagged, not blocked, this round only. Sign your plugin bundle before upload; unsigned bundles are rejected by the gate. Use the key below.

rollout seal: bky4_DFM9

Subject: Key rotation for DedupeDaisy

Hey — quick heads up before you review my PR: I rotated the credentials for the DedupeDaisy merge service, so the old key in your local env won't work against staging anymore. Nothing else changed in the auth flow. Update your env with the new key below.

app token of badug-tahaf = qvz11-nP5FBNr8qnh

## Break-Glass: ScanBridge Barcode Integration

If the ScanBridge listener wedges and warehouse scanners at the Drellford site go dark, you'll need break-glass access to the pairing console. Normal SSO won't work because the console predates our identity migration (sorry, future maintainer). Restart the pairing daemon first — that fixes 90% of cases. If not, unlock the emergency console with the recovery passphrase below.

strongbox words: briiel-zoreth-noveth-pelys-druwyn-feniel-lamvan-ulaius-kasion

Team,

Quick update for finance. Our sole supplier for the Ferrowave controller remains Trellick Components. Risk is unacceptable given their recent delivery slips. Procurement has shortlisted two candidates: Osmund Fabrication and Kirelle Parts. Qualification samples due in four weeks. Budget impact: roughly 3% unit cost increase during dual-sourcing, offset by reduced expedite fees. Decision gate at next exec review. No external communication until contracts are signed. Rationale and sensitivities are noted confidentially below.

management briefing: Project Ulavan slips by two quarters because of the staffing delay.

# Break-Glass: Fennelgate Cache Layer

Context: postmortem PM-42, stale-cache bug served week-old prices. Break-glass lets you flush all cache tiers at once. Reviewer: confirm the flush script now checks replica lag first. Use only during active incidents; log every invocation. The flush credentials unseal with the recovery passphrase below.

unlock words, yawig-kagef: gordor-holvan-ulaael-pramir-ulaiel-tamdor